如何使用 PC3000 Flash 蜘蛛板适配器
在2017年3月的布拉格一体FLASH存储会议上,ACE实验室宣布了一种新的蜘蛛板适配器,用于方便读取一体FLASH存储。在本文中,我们将描述此适配器的主要特性,并展示MicroSD读取的示例。
PC-3000闪光蜘蛛板适配器是一种通用的安全一体FLASH存储数据恢复解决方案,无需繁琐的焊接!使用它,您不需要特定的适配器来处理您处理的每个一体FLASH存储。
它设计用于连接基于NAND的闪存驱动器的内部触点,这些驱动器是作为单封装芯片(单片)制造的。适配器由25个通用触点组成,支持在相应任务中与NAND接口信号关联的软件配置。请注意,适配器仅由PC-3000 Flash Reader 4.0支持。
观看下面的视频,全面了解Spider Board适配器和MicroSD读取过程示例:
Spider板是一种非常智能的硬件配置,基于完整的可配置Xilinx微芯片。它是一个具有多种功能的完整系统,不断更新和改进。 Spider Board适配器有两个主要功能:能够从广泛的整体设备中读取数据;
使用mSD,SD,eMMC设备在卡适配器模式下工作的机会(在新任务创建期间必须在设备选项中选择卡适配器)。
目前,我们正在努力添加其他功能,这些功能可以显着改善自动引脚分析研究或逻辑分析仪功能。 继续查看有关PC-3000 Flash的更新和新闻!
注1:
适配器的针状引脚基本上是复杂的防噪声触点,设计考虑到设备的技术任务和细节。 它们镀镍以防止氧化,并且部分覆盖有特殊的尖端涂层以防止短路。
针头非常灵活,可以安装在整体上的Pin Map垫上。 使用显微镜检查所有针头是否正确排列,并且在固定后不会从Pin Map垫移动到任何位置:
为避免任何损害,请记住以下方案:
在不固定螺钉的情况下,可以拉伸针。 当您要使用翼形螺钉进行固定时,针边的位置会发生偏移:
如果您弯曲,拧紧或以某种方式损坏蜘蛛板适配器的针头,请不要担心。 您可以随时订购一套额外的蜘蛛板neeedle并替换坏的蜘蛛板。
笔记2:
新的适配器有两种提供电源的方式 – 从针头和扩展的蛤蜊输出。 基本上,没有焊接就可以完全使用monolith – 你需要的只是在同一个引脚(VCC,GND)上为GND和2-3安排在VCC上安装2-3针。
为了提供良好的电源电流,请使用多个针用于PWR和GND,而不是将它们用于其他重要的触点。 只要有可能,应使用直径至少为0.2 mm的绞合导线将电源和接地触点连接到整体件上! 较厚的导线横截面将始终为整体材料提供更好的PWR供应。
注意:为了获得更好的读数结果,我们建议您注意电线(它们应该短而宽)和电源焊接(使用助焊剂和焊锡)。
注3:
读取芯片ID或NAND图像的能力取决于整体内部结构的类型。 有两种不同的类型:
从技术引脚图到CPU和NAND内核的独立总线:
Type 1
- 通过控制器芯片从技术引脚图到NAND内核的公共总线:
Type 2
通常,读取Type 1芯片没有问题。您只需要安排引脚并开始读取过程。
对于Type 2芯片,数据恢复任务变得更加复杂。从Type 2方案可以看出,来自技术引脚的总线通过CPU,而控制器可能会影响传输数据的可能性。所有闪存驱动器损坏的主要原因是固件问题。但CPU,缓冲器和NAND等硬件部件仍处于运行状态。上电时,CPU开始工作,可能会阻止通过Techno Pins访问NAND内核。以下是此类行为的典型迹象:
ID读取错误(错过或混合字节:而不是0x45DE9493,它可能读取0xDE949345,或0x45009493);
ID正常读取但转储不读取(中止错误);
ID未读取(0xFFFFFF,0x000000,0x6C6C6C6C6C);
如果您遇到其中一个问题,您应该了解CPU影响可能存在的问题。
以下是几种绕过CPU影响的方法:
您可以尝试使用选项 – > PC-3000 FLASH参数 – >电源适配器控制将电源值降至2.4V – 2.8V:
在较低的电压下,一体FLASH存储的控制器可能会关闭,并且可以在没有任何噪声或来自CPU侧的阻塞命令的情况下读取NAND芯片。但要小心 – 太小的电压可能是关闭NAND缓冲器的原因。在这种情况下,在重新启动电源之前,无法进行转储读取。这就是为什么你需要从2.4V到2.8V选择几个值并找到芯片ID和转储读取的理想值。
另一种方式 – 物理控制器破坏。此方法仅适用于有经验的工程师。请注意,这是非常危险的,因为你可能会损坏一体FLASH存储的内部结构,使你的一体FLASH存储设备无法恢复!您可以自担风险使用以下操作。
对于物理控制器的破坏,您应该知道控制器的确切位置。如果没有X-RAY图片,就无法找到CPU。一旦你制作了单块内部结构的X-RAY图片,你就能找到控制器晶圆并用非常薄的螺旋钻钻孔(或者只是刮擦)。在那之后,总线将免受控制器影响,并且可以读取整个转储。
UFD整体设备内控制器放置的示例№1